Monophyletic (noun) Definition, Meaning & Examples
Monophyletic (noun) Definition, Meaning & Examples
Admin
adjective
consisting of organisms descended from a single taxon.
adjective
relating to or characterized by descent from a single ancestral group of animals or plants
(of animals or plants) of or belonging to a single stock
